Advancing Tandem Organic Solar Cells With Ternary Acceptor Control for High‐Power Modules and Solar‐to‐Ammonia Conversion

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Tandem organic solar cells with optimized ternary acceptor engineering achieved a power conversion efficiency of 15.53% and enabled a high‐voltage mini‐module (Voc 6.11 V). Integration into a bias‐free PV‐EC system further demonstrated efficient solar‐to‐ammonia (STA) conversion (97% Faradaic Efficiency, 4± 2% STA efficiency), highlighting scalable ...

Observation of correlations between forward protons and 90$^0$ trigger protons at $\sqrt{s}$ = 62 GeV

open access: yes, 1986
We study the production of π + 's and protons at 90° with p t>1.15 GeV and their correlations with forward protons. Fewer forward protons are observed for a 90° proton trigger than for a π + trigger.

Spin-spin coupling between protons bonded to sp2 and sp3 hybridized benzylic carbon atoms and ring protons

open access: yes, 1968
Deviations from symmetry in inherently symmetrical N.M.R. spectra were used to study long-range spin-spin coupling between benzylic protons and ring protons.
